Four is max Posted by Ari [Email] ![]() ![]() In Reply to: How do you clear the alarm ECU to get new remotes in?, turrbo ![]() ![]() |
The system comes slots for four remotes. If they're full up, you need to erase all of them and re-program the ones you have. There is a window that allows you to erase all of the remotes.
It will give you a very scary screen warning that if you do this, you may never get the car to run. I don't know your location, but this isn't a problem in the US. It's a possibility with the UK alarm system, and in the later NG900. But it's not a problem with the less sophisticated US-market alarm system.
This happened to me - the '97 I bought came with one remote, but all four slots were programmed. The Previous Owner liked to lose remotes. I bought a new remote (eBay) and went to the dealer to program it. All four were full, and the dealer was scared by the screen, and refused to erase the remotes. At the last Saab Tech Session, John Moss came out with a Tech 2 and did it in less than a minute. He explained the scary screen.
SO just erase all of the remotes, then reprogram in the two (or one or three) you have. No biggie.
